Summary: Female Pants/Baggy/Shredded has an odd behavior, including the ability to select a 'Tattered' pants category that doesn't exist elsewhere, and the ability to select a torn-edge pants texture that doesn't exist elsewhere.

 

Steps to reproduce:

  • Take a female character into the costume editor.
  • Select 'Pants' for lower body.
  • Select 'Baggy' for Pants type
  • Select 'Shredded' for the subtype.

 

This causes 'Baggy' to be replaced with 'Tattered'. Then you can further explore this by:

  • Clicking 'Tattered' but NOT selecting any of the options. Just click in the dead space next to the menu, allowing 'Tattered' to remain.
  • Click 'Shredded'. You can select 'Long' and 'Short' to see different options. 'Long' brings up that torn-edge texture. Short doesn't do anything. 'Motorcycle leathers' and 'Baggy Cargo' do what you'd expect.
